Jabal Wahban
Jabal Wahban is a peak in Saada, Yemen and has an elevation of 2,036 metres. Jabal Wahban is situated nearby to the village Ghuraz, as well as near the hamlet Al Mahjar.- Type: Peak with an elevation of 2,036 metres
- Description: mountain in Sa’adah District, Yemen
- Also known as: “Jabal Wahbān”
